The Science of Venom
Definition and Composition of Venom
Venom is one of nature’s most intricate biochemical marvels, designed for both defense and predation by various venomous animals. By definition, venom is a toxic substance produced by animals such as snakes, spiders, and scorpions, which is injected into another organism through a bite, sting, or other specialized mechanism. The composition of venom is a complex cocktail of proteins, enzymes, and peptides, each tailored to target specific physiological systems of their prey or threats. For instance, neurotoxins disrupt nerve transmission, causing paralysis, while hemotoxins can damage blood cells and blood vessels, leading to tissue necrosis.
The diversity of venom is astounding, with each species evolving its unique concoction to optimize survival. The adaptability of venom reflects millions of years of evolution, resulting in some of the most effective natural poisons known to man. This biochemical sophistication not only underscores the lethal potential of venom but also highlights its role in the ecological niches occupied by these creatures.

How Venom Affects Victims
The impact of venom on victims varies widely, depending on the type of venom and the species it comes from. Venomous animals have fine-tuned their toxins to achieve specific biological effects that incapacitate their prey swiftly. For instance, the venom of an Inland Taipan, often regarded as the most venomous snake, can cause rapid systemic damage by disrupting the victim’s nervous system, leading to symptoms like convulsions, respiratory failure, and even death if untreated.
Similarly, the venom of a Brazilian Wandering Spider can induce intense pain, swelling, and in severe cases, paralysis. The mechanisms by which these venoms operate are a testament to their evolutionary refinement, allowing predators to subdue prey efficiently and deter potential threats.
In addition to their immediate effects, venoms have long-term implications for medical research. Scientists are increasingly studying these natural poisons to develop new pharmaceuticals, such as painkillers and blood pressure medications, transforming what once was a lethal weapon into a potential lifesaver.

The Most Venomous Land Animals
Snakes: Masters of Venom
Snakes have long captivated the human imagination with their cunning and, in many cases, their deadly venom. These venomous animals are true masters of adaptation, having developed complex venom delivery systems to subdue prey and deter predators. Among the most notorious is the Inland Taipan, often referred to as the “fierce snake”. Found in Australia, its venom is the most toxic of any land snake, capable of causing paralysis and death within hours. Despite its fearsome reputation, the Inland Taipan is shy and reclusive, rarely seen by humans.
Another infamous snake is the King Cobra, known for its impressive size and potent venom. Unlike many other snakes, the King Cobra can deliver multiple bites in one encounter, injecting a large volume of venom. This venom acts quickly to incapacitate prey, a necessity for this predator that often hunts other snakes. The King Cobra’s elegant yet intimidating presence is a testament to nature’s ingenuity in the evolution of venomous animals.

Spiders: Tiny Yet Deadly
While they might be small, spiders are among the most efficient predators in the animal kingdom, thanks in large part to their venom. The Brazilian Wandering Spider, also known as the “banana spider”, is one of the most venomous spiders on Earth. Its venom can cause extreme pain, loss of muscle control, and even death if not treated promptly. Despite its dangerous nature, this spider plays a crucial role in controlling insect populations in its native habitat.
Another formidable arachnid is the Sydney Funnel-Web Spider. Found in Australia, this spider’s venom is potent enough to kill a human within hours. However, thanks to advances in medical treatments and awareness, fatalities are rare. The Sydney Funnel-Web’s aggressive behavior and powerful venom make it a creature to be respected and approached with caution.

Aquatic Venomous Creatures
The ocean is home to some of the most fascinating and venomous animals on Earth. These creatures have adapted to their watery environments with deadly precision, using venom as a means of defense and predation. Among these, jellyfish, sea anemones, fish, and mollusks stand out as particularly potent.
Deadly Jellyfish and Sea Anemones
Jellyfish and sea anemones are among the most infamous of the ocean’s venomous inhabitants. The box jellyfish, for instance, is notorious for its lethal sting. Found in the Indo-Pacific region, its venom can cause cardiac arrest within minutes, making it one of the ocean’s most feared creatures. The transparent nature of jellyfish often makes them hard to spot, adding to the peril they pose to unsuspecting swimmers.
Sea anemones, while often stationary and seemingly benign, also wield powerful venom. They use their stinging cells, called nematocysts, to immobilize prey and deter predators. Despite their beauty, both jellyfish and sea anemones remind us that the ocean is a realm where danger often lurks in unexpected forms.

Venomous Fish and Mollusks
The aquatic world also hosts a plethora of venomous fish and mollusks. Among them, the stonefish is particularly feared. Often camouflaged as a rock on the ocean floor, the stonefish possesses venomous spines that can deliver excruciating pain and even death if not treated promptly. This makes it a formidable presence in the waters of the Indo-Pacific.
Mollusks like the blue-ringed octopus are small but extremely dangerous. This tiny creature, found in tide pools and coral reefs, carries venom potent enough to cause paralysis and death in humans. The fact that there is no known antivenom heightens its threat level. Cone snails, with their beautiful shells, hide another lethal secret: a harpoon-like tooth equipped with venom that can paralyze prey almost instantly.

Venom in Medical Research
Beyond their ecological role, venomous animals have significantly impacted the field of medical research. Scientists have long been fascinated by the complex composition of venom, which contains a wide array of biologically active compounds. These compounds have the potential to revolutionize medicine. For instance, venom components are being studied for their potential to treat chronic pain, as some venoms can block specific pain pathways without the addictive side effects of traditional painkillers.
Moreover, the venom of certain species, like the cone snail, has yielded compounds that are being researched for their potential in cancer treatment, showcasing the untapped potential of nature’s pharmacy. The study of venom has also led to the development of antivenoms and treatments for snake bites and other venomous encounters, saving countless lives each year.

Coexisting with Venomous Wildlife
Safety Tips and Precautions
Living in harmony with venomous animals requires awareness and respect for their habitats. These creatures, though potentially dangerous, are vital members of our ecosystems. Here are some essential safety tips to help ensure peaceful coexistence:
-
Educate Yourself: Understanding which venomous animals inhabit your area is the first step in ensuring safety. This knowledge allows you to recognize potential threats and respond appropriately.
-
Wear Protective Clothing: When hiking or exploring areas known for venomous wildlife, wear long sleeves, pants, and sturdy boots. This attire can provide a barrier against bites or stings.
-
Stay on Trails: Venturing off marked paths increases the risk of encountering venomous animals. Stick to established trails where visibility is better, and you’re less likely to disturb wildlife.
-
Be Cautious Near Water: Many venomous creatures, like certain snakes and the box jellyfish, often inhabit water bodies. Exercise caution when swimming or wading in unfamiliar waters.
-
Immediate Medical Attention: If bitten or stung, seek medical help immediately. Knowing basic first aid for venomous bites can also be lifesaving while waiting for professional assistance.
